ontwerpbeginselen
Ontwerpbeginselen, or design principles, are fundamental guidelines that inform the creation and development of products, systems, or services. These principles serve as a compass for designers, ensuring that their work is coherent, functional, and user-centered. They are often derived from user needs, market research, and industry best practices. Common design principles include usability, accessibility, consistency, and aesthetics. Usability focuses on making products intuitive and easy to use, while accessibility ensures that all users, regardless of their abilities, can interact with the product. Consistency involves maintaining a uniform look and feel across different elements of the design, which helps users understand and navigate the product more easily. Aesthetics, on the other hand, deals with the visual appeal and emotional impact of the design. By adhering to these principles, designers can create products that are not only visually appealing but also highly functional and user-friendly.
